Aiming at the problems of permanent support time and excess support during the excavation of the 470 north wing auxiliary transportation rock roadway in Changcun Mine, after analyzing the reasons for the unreasonable arrangement of the support cables in the roadway, the layout of anchor cables was optimized, and the FLAC3D numerical simulation method was used to simulate the surrounding rock deformation law of the roadway under different support schemes. The optimal support method for achieving 470 North Wing auxiliary transportation rapid roadway formation was given as 3-0-2-0-3 big five flower anchor cable arrangement. The field application showed that the total support time of the roadway was reduced by 3.5 hours per original five rows.
